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/332.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/selenium/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 通过Selenium中的窗口提示处理上载文件,C_C#_Selenium_Selenium Webdriver - Fatal编程技术网

C# 通过Selenium中的窗口提示处理上载文件,C

C# 通过Selenium中的窗口提示处理上载文件,C,c#,selenium,selenium-webdriver,C#,Selenium,Selenium Webdriver,当我试图打开这样的文件时,我会看到窗口对话框。 所以我需要设置文件路径并单击OK按钮。Selenium没有它的本机功能。我发现了它在java上的作用: StringSelection abc= new StringSelection("E:\\Study Materials\\Resume And Cv\\Sample 1_0.doc"); Toolkit.getDefaultToolkit().getSystemClipboard().setContents(abc, null); Robot

当我试图打开这样的文件时,我会看到窗口对话框。 所以我需要设置文件路径并单击OK按钮。Selenium没有它的本机功能。我发现了它在java上的作用:

StringSelection abc= new StringSelection("E:\\Study Materials\\Resume And Cv\\Sample 1_0.doc");
Toolkit.getDefaultToolkit().getSystemClipboard().setContents(abc, null);
Robot robot = new Robot();
robot.keyPress(KeyEvent.VK_ENTER);
robot.keyRelease(KeyEvent.VK_ENTER);

类似的东西在C中是否支持?

我在下面的文章中找到了答案-我发送了路径并输入了按键。

答案需要包含的不仅仅是一个链接,请包含它如何工作的完整描述。